| 20100213628 | METHODS AND COMPOSITIONS FOR ENCAPSULATING ACTIVE AGENTS - Methods for making self-assembled, selectively permeable elastic microscopie structures, referred to herein as colloidosomes, that have controlled pore-size, porosity and advantageous mechanical properties are described. In one form of the invention, a method of forming colloidosomes includes providing particles formed from a biocompatible material in a first solvent and forming an emulsion by adding a first fluid to the first solvent wherein the emulsion is defined by droplets of the first fluid surrounded by the first solvent. The method includes coating the surface of droplet with the particles and the stabilizing the particles on the surface of droplet. The colloidosomes produced typically have a yield strength of at least about 20 Pascals. In certain forms of the invention, the particles are spherical and are formed of a biocompatible polymer. Colloidosomes formed according to the methods described herein are also provided. In one form, a colloidosome includes a shell formed of biocompatible, substantially spherical particles wherein each of the particles are linked to neighboring particles. The shell defines an inner chamber sized for housing a desired active agent and has a plurality of pores extending therethrough. The colloidosomes are structurally stable, typically having a yield strength of at least about 20 Pascals. Colloidal suspension and methods of encapsulating a desired active agent are also described | 08-26-2010 |

| 20110254544 | METHOD AND DEVICE FOR MEASURING THE LAYER THICKNESS OF PARTIALLY SOLIDIFIED MELTS - The present invention relates to a method and a device for measuring the layer thickness of partially solidified melts, particularly on a conveyor belt, during continuous casting. In order to determine the layer thickness, magnetic fields are used, which are created by means of electromagnetic stirring coils that are present on one side of the layer. The reduced magnetic field is then detected on the other side of the layer and is used for calculating the layer thickness. | 10-20-2011 |

| 20090274019 | Optical Scanning Apparatus for Appliances for Recording or Reproducing Information Using an Optical Recording Medium - The invention provides an optical scanning apparatus for appliances for recording or reproducing information using an optical recording medium, said scanning apparatus automatically matching itself to the curvature of a curved recording medium or of a recording medium with axial runout without there being different wire diameters for the resilient support of the lens holder (LH) or other additional damping means or an additional control loop for this purpose. This object is achieved by virtue of an arrangement comprising coils and magnets being provided which has an asymmetrical magnetic field distribution which is provided for matching the orientation of a lens (L) in the optical scanning device to a curved recording medium or to any axial runout in the recording medium. The asymmetrical magnetic field distribution is achieved with magnets arranged offset laterally or with magnets (MS) which are bevelled on one side or with a focusing coil which is asymmetrically shaped or is arranged asymmetrically with respect to the magnets. The individual embodiments for achieving an asymmetrical magnetic field distribution can be combined with one another. | 11-05-2009 |
